For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 168 students in Latrobe School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 5% of public elementary schools in California.
Public Elementary Schools in Latrobe School District have an average math proficiency score of 69% (versus the California public elementary school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 73% (versus the 45%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 26%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public elementary school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$18,548 in this school district is less than the state median of $19,979. The school district revenue/student has declined by 11%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$15,149 is less than the state median of $18,400. The school district spending/student has declined by 11% over four school years.
